AI Summary
-
Adds Section 34-9-43.2 to the Alabama Code to clarify the Board of Dental Examiners' rulemaking authority regarding state and federal anti-trust laws.
-
Immunizes the Board of Dental Examiners, its members, employees, and agents from anti-trust liability when adopting rules that prioritize patient health, safety, and welfare, even if those rules appear anti-competitive or have anti-competitive effects.
-
Permits the Board to define and regulate the practice of dentistry, dental hygiene, and expanded duty dental assisting in ways that prioritize patient health, safety, and welfare under existing Sections 34-9-18 and 34-9-43.
-
Requires that Board rules may supplement or clarify statutory definitions but cannot conflict with existing statutes defining dental practice, dental hygiene, and expanded duty dental assisting.
-
Takes effect immediately upon passage and approval by the Governor.
